Fitzroy Island Bounces Back after Cyclone Ita

Fitzroy Island

Fitzroy Island bounces back and is OPEN for business as normal from Monday 14th April

For the safety of guests and staff the island was evacuated last Thursday. A small team lead by resort owner Doug Gamble and General Manager Glen MacDonald, remained on the Island throughout the storm. Cyclone Ita passed over the island late on Saturday night and the resort team quickly cleared away fallen trees and debris left by high winds.

The five sea turtles living in the tanks at the Turtle Rehabilitation Centre were moved to a purpose built cyclone safe enclosure in a secure area. The turtles were moved back into the sea turtle centre on Sunday by our staff.

Glen MacDonald reported, “the conditions were extreme, guests were safely evacuated prior to Ita's arrival, we were lucky as no damage was sustained and are pleased to report within 24 hours it is back to business as usual, the seas are flat and calm, the suns out and we look forward to welcoming returning guests.”

About Fitzroy Island Resort

Just 45-minutes from Cairns by the Fitzroy Fast Cat, Fitzroy Island offers visitors a range of activities including snorkeling on coral reefs, sea kayaking, learning to dive, glass bottom boat tours, rainforest walks, relaxing at the pool bar, chilling out on the beach or taking a tour to see the Turtle Rehabilitation Centre.

One of the most unspoiled islands on the Great Barrier Reef, the majority of Fitzroy Island is a National Island Park. The continental island is 339 hectares in size, with 324 hectares of protected National Park.

Fitzroy Island is surrounded by fringing reef, which is the home to a variety of tropical fish and coral life, the Island and its surrounding reef make up part of the Great Barrier Reef, a protected World Heritage Site, and one of the seven natural wonders of the world.
